Junior Crew Planning Assistant
Department: Operations
Reports to: Head Ops.
Direction Location: Zaragoza -Spain
Contract Type: Full-time / Permanent
Level: Junior / Entry-level (engineering degree not mandatory)
Key Responsibilities Support daily crew rostering in compliance with current FTL regulations (EASA or other applicable). Assist in handling short-notice operational disruptions (delays, swaps, absences). Coordinate with Operations, OCC and HR departments. Update planning tools and crew management software (Leon). Contribute to post-flight reporting and crew compliance analysis.
Requirements Vocational or university-level training in aviation, administration, or similar. Knowledge of FTL rules or crew scheduling tools is a plus. Proficient in MS Office; crew planning software experience is a plus. Intermediate to upper-intermediate English (B1–B2). Strong organizational and communication skills; team-oriented.
